Paragon Development Finance has provided a £5.32 million financing facility for the Kelham Exchange project. This construction project comprises a mixed-use development and is located in the Kelham Island district of Sheffield. The development is designed to create 43 apartments and four commercial units, reflecting the growing demand for urban living spaces and commercial premises in this region.
The financing extends over a period of 22 months. It supports Catherall Developments Ltd in realising the project. The loan-to-value (LTV) is 65% based on a gross development value (GDV) of £8.248 million. This underscores the confidence in the economic viability and potential of the project.
Kelham Island has developed into a dynamic district in Sheffield in recent years. Formerly an industrial area, it is now undergoing a profound transformation through investment in residential and commercial properties. Projects like Kelham Exchange contribute to the further revitalisation of this district and offer modern infrastructure that attracts both residents and businesses. The combination of residential and commercial spaces is typical of urban development policies aimed at creating vibrant and functional city districts.
The Kelham Exchange project will thus play an important role in the consolidation and further development of Kelham Island. The 43 apartments address a need for high-quality housing, while the four commercial units can stimulate the local economy and create jobs. Such mixed-use projects are crucial for strengthening urban areas and creating balanced infrastructure.
